Who is Toyo Tires owned by?

Toyo Tire Holdings of Americas Inc. (TTHA) is the wholly-owned North American subsidiary of Toyo Tire Corporation of Osaka, Japan. Headquartered in Cypress, California, TTHA and its group companies manufacture, import, sell and distribute Toyo and Nitto brand tires in the U.S. and Canada.

Are Toyo Tires made by Toyota?

Toyo Tyre & Rubber are an international manufacturer of rubber and tires founded and headquartered in Japan. There is no relation to Toyota Motors.

Are Toyo tires Japanese?

Toyo was founded in Japan in 1945. Making their entry into the U.S. market in 1966, they became the first Japanese tire manufacturer to establish a market in the United States when they opened a warehouse and distribution center in Southern California.

Who did Goodyear merge with?

AKRON, OH – June 7, 2021 - The Goodyear Tire & Rubber Company (Nasdaq: GT) today announced that it has completed its acquisition of Cooper Tire & Rubber Company, finalizing the merger agreement made public on February 22.

What company makes Cooper Tires?

In June, Cooper Tire became part of The Goodyear Tire & Rubber Company, combining two leading companies with complementary product portfolios, services and capabilities and creating a strong U.S.-based leader in the global tire industry.
